It’s an exciting time for K‑pop fans, with some of the industry’s biggest names (and a few unexpected units) gearing up to release new music.
From cinematic storylines to bold concept shifts, these upcoming projects promise to set the tone for the months ahead. Here’s a breakdown of what’s on the horizon.
BTS - ARIRANG
Global pop superstars BTS release their highly anticipated 5th album, 'ARIRANG' - the first group release in over three years! The album indicates the forthcoming direction for the band, with each member deeply involved in the creative process. They’re back and better than ever! Out on the 20th March.

ATEEZ - GOLDEN HOUR: Part 4
ATEEZ are back and moving forward once more. The fourth chapter of the GOLDEN HOUR series continues its ongoing narrative of rebellion, restoration, and breaking free from what once was. Known for their high-intensity performances and lore-driven albums, this release is expected to take both their sound and storytelling even further.
With themes of balance and self‑determination at its core, GOLDEN HOUR: Part 4 feels like a turning point… not just in the storyline, but in ATEEZ’s evolution as a group. Out on 6th February.

BLACKPINK - [DEADLINE]
BLACKPINK return with DEADLINE, their first full-group album in four years. The record showcases their musical evolution and artistic versatility, moving through a range of styles and genres to create an empowering, high-energy experience for fans. Highly anticipated by audiences worldwide, DEADLINE further cements BLACKPINK’s global presence while offering a glimpse into the direction the group is heading next. Out on 27th February.

LE SSERAFIM - SPAGHETTI
LE SSERAFIM have officially released SPAGHETTI, delivering a bold and playful album that leans fully into the group’s confident, genre-blurring identity. The release stands out for its cheeky attitude and sharp performance energy, balancing irony with a polished pop sensibility.
Rather than following expectations, SPAGHETTI thrives on its unconventional charm, reinforcing LE SSERAFIM’s reputation for turning unexpected concepts into standout moments. It’s a release that feels fun, fearless, and unmistakably them. Out now.

DxS (SEVENTEEN) - Serenade
SEVENTEEN’s special unit DxS is drawing attention for its potential to spotlight a different dynamic within the group. Unit projects have long been a strength for SEVENTEEN, allowing members to explore distinct sounds and performance styles.
Whether focused on experimentation or refinement, DxS is one to watch for fans interested in a more concentrated, concept‑driven release, and Serenade does not disappoint. Out on16th Jan.

ENHYPEN - THE SIN: VANISH
ENHYPEN continues to expand their dark, supernatural‑inspired universe with THE SIN: VANISH. Building on themes of temptation, identity, and transformation, this project is expected to deepen the group’s lore while showcasing a more mature sonic direction.
With each comeback, ENHYPEN sharpen their narrative and performance intensity… and VANISH looks set to be another bold chapter in their ongoing story. Out on 16th Jan.
